The Ministry of Expatriate Welfare and Overseas Employment will provide education scholarships to the children of expatriate workers who have passed SSC or equivalent examination in 2020.
This has been informed through a notification recently.
The children of those who have travelled abroad with clearance from the Bureau of Manpower, Employment and Training (BMET) or who have become members of the Wage Earners Welfare Board (WEEB) through embassies or high commissions working abroad can apply for the scholarship till 30th June, next month.
Later, the students nominated for the scholarship will get the scholarship at the determined rate.

In addition, to apply directly, one can collect the free application form from the website of the board, which is to be sent to WEWB, 8th floor, Probashi Kallyan Bhaban, 71-72 Old Elephant Road, Eskaton Garden, Ramna, Dhaka-1000 by letter.
At the time of application, photocopy of the passport, visa, pass with the exit clearance / manpower clearance of BMET or membership of Wage Earners Welfare Board through Bangladesh Mission abroad of the expatiate should be submitted.
In addition, the applicant has been asked to submit 2 passport size photos and photocopy of the original mark sheet of SSC / equivalent examination, attested by the head of the respective educational institution. In the case of children of late expatriate workers, No Objection Certificate (NOC) issued by Bangladesh Mission abroad has to be issued. However, no need to submit these documents in the initial way if one applies online.
Scholarships for SSC / equivalent category will be given to students studying up to class XI and XII for 2 years and for those studying in diploma for 4 years, at the rate of Tk 2,000 per month. In addition, the scholarship will be accompanied by an annual one-time book and educational materials and other ancillary expenses of Tk 3,500.
